Warning Signs You Need Restaurant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s, lost revenue, and even health risks for your customers and staff. Our team is here to help you identify the signs of water damage and prevent further issues.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Musty smells can be a sign of mold growth, which can spread quickly and pose serious health risks. If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your restaurant, it’s essential to address the issue immediately.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or excessive moisture. This can lead to further issues, such as structural damage or even collapse. Don’t ignore this warning sign, call our team today.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of water damage. This can lead to costly repairs and even compromise the structural integrity of your restaurant.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Burst pipe in the kitchen Yes Yes Due to the risk of electrical shock and water damage, it’s best to call a professional to handle the situation.
Small leak under the sink Yes No You can handle small leaks yourself, but be sure to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Storm surge damage to the exterior of the building No Yes Storm surge damage can be extensive and need specialized equipment and expertise to repair.
Mold growth in the walls or ceilings No Yes Mold growth can be hazardous to your health and need spec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ely.
Water damage to electrical parts No Yes Water damage to electrical parts can be a serious safety hazard and need the expertise of a professional.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Cost in Silverlake, TX

The cost of restaurant water damage restoration can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Silverlake, TX.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the work.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Dehumidification and cleaning $300 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and level of contamination
Reconstruction and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Scope of work, materials needed, and labor costs
Final inspection and walkthrough $100 – $300 Complexity of the job and level of detail required
